Crime Statistics Comparison: Cedar rapids vs Jay
- In Jay, the total crime rate is higher at 35.89 incidents per 1000 compared to 33.4 in Cedar rapids.
- The property crime rate is higher in Cedar rapids at 30.23 incidents per 1000 compared to 29.36 in Jay.
- The violent crime rate in Jay is higher at 6.53 incidents per 1000 compared to 3.17 in Cedar rapids.
- The unemployment rate is higher in Cedar rapids at 4.3% compared to 3.2% in Jay.
- The poverty rate in Jay is higher at 14% compared to 10% in Cedar rapids.
